Coronavirus
(COVID-19) Information for the Town of Landover
Hills
(Updated March 17, 2020)
Hotline
and Coronavirus COVID-19 Resources: Prince
George’s County has established a hotline to use for COVID
19 questions. The
number is (301) 883-6627.
The hotline is operational during the hours of 8:00am to
8:00pm.
Please contact 911 for medical
emergencies only.
Do not contact 911 for Coronavirus related issues.

Town Hall:
The Town
of Landover Hills' highest priority is the safety and
well-being of our
residents, staff and visitors. Consistent with expert public
health guidance
related to the spread of COVID-19, the following changes
have been made to Town
Hall operations until further notice. These changes are
being made for the
purpose of protecting health and safety.
The
Landover Hills Town Hall is closed to walk-ins. Please call (301)
773-6401 for Town matters
and information.
Police
Department:
For
emergencies, please call 911.
If you
need to make a police report that is NOT AN EMERGENCY please
call (301) 352-1200
(the Prince George's County dispatch) and an officer will
either take your
police report by telephone or an officer will be dispatched
to your location.
Redlight
and Speed Camera violation payments can be dropped off
through the mail slot in the
front door of Town Hall or made on-line or by phone. Please follow the
directions on your ticket
or call 301-773-6400 with any
questions.
To obtain
a vehicle release or pick up a police report,
please call (301) 773-6400
for an appointment.
Municipal
Infractions or Code Issues:
For Town
Code violations, please make your payment by mail or through
the mail slot in
the front door of Town Hall. Any questions or concerns, please call
301-773-6401.
Public
Works:
Trash –
Regular trash collection continues. Yard
waste will be picked-up with the regular trash through May
1, 2020. Beginning
May 4, 2020, yard waste will be
picked-up on Monday’s. Any
questions or
concerns, please call 301-773-6401.
Parks:
In
accordance with the Governor’s Executive order 20-03-23-01,
no more than 10
people are permitted in the fenced playground at any time.
